package com.bsth.util;
import org.apache.http.HttpEntity;
import org.apache.http.client.config.RequestConfig;
import org.apache.http.client.entity.EntityBuilder;
import org.apache.http.client.methods.CloseableHttpResponse;
import org.apache.http.client.methods.HttpGet;
import org.apache.http.client.methods.HttpPost;
import org.apache.http.conn.ssl.SSLConnectionSocketFactory;
import org.apache.http.entity.StringEntity;
import org.apache.http.impl.client.CloseableHttpClient;
import org.apache.http.impl.client.HttpClients;
import org.slf4j.Logger;
import org.slf4j.LoggerFactory;
import javax.net.ssl.*;
import java.io.BufferedReader;
import java.io.IOException;
import java.io.InputStreamReader;
import java.security.cert.CertificateException;
import java.security.cert.X509Certificate;
import java.util.HashMap;
import java.util.Map;
/**
* Created by panzhao on 2017/8/2.
*/
public class HttpClientUtils {
static Logger logger = LoggerFactory.getLogger(HttpClientUtils.class);
private final static String HTTPS = "https://";
private static SSLConnectionSocketFactory sslConnectionSocketFactory;
static {
try {
SSLContext sslCtx = SSLContext.getInstance("TLSv1.2");
sslCtx.init(null, new TrustManager[] {
new X509TrustManager() {
@Override
public void checkClientTrusted(X509Certificate[] x509Certificates, String s) throws CertificateException {
}
@Override
public void checkServerTrusted(X509Certificate[] x509Certificates, String s) throws CertificateException {
}
@Override
public X509Certificate[] getAcceptedIssuers() {
return null;
}
}
}, null);
sslConnectionSocketFactory = new SSLConnectionSocketFactory(sslCtx, new HostnameVerifier() {
@Override
public boolean verify(String hostname, SSLSession session) {
// TODO Auto-generated method stub
return true;
}
});
} catch (Exception e) {
logger.error("SSL context set fail: {}", e);
}
}
public static CloseableHttpClient defaultHttpClient(String url) {
if (url.startsWith(HTTPS)) {
return HttpClients.custom().setSSLSocketFactory(sslConnectionSocketFactory).build();
}
return HttpClients.createDefault();
}
public static StringBuilder get(String url) throws Exception {
CloseableHttpClient httpClient = null;
CloseableHttpResponse response = null;
StringBuilder stringBuffer = null;
try {
httpClient = defaultHttpClient(url);
HttpGet get = new HttpGet(url);
//超时时间
RequestConfig requestConfig = RequestConfig.custom()
.setConnectTimeout(10500).setConnectionRequestTimeout(7000)
.setSocketTimeout(10500).build();
get.setConfig(requestConfig);
get.addHeader("Content-Encoding", "gzip");
response = httpClient.execute(get);
stringBuffer = getResult(response.getEntity());
} catch (Exception e) {
logger.error("", e);
} finally {
if (null != httpClient)
httpClient.close();
if (null != response)
response.close();
}
return stringBuffer;
}
/**
* raw post data
* @param url
* @param data
* @return
*/
public static StringBuilder post(String url, String data) throws Exception {
return post(url, data, new HashMap<>());
}
public static StringBuilder post(String url, String data, Map<String, Object> headers) throws Exception {
CloseableHttpClient httpClient = null;
CloseableHttpResponse response = null;
StringBuilder stringBuffer = null;
try {
httpClient = defaultHttpClient(url);
HttpPost post = new HttpPost(url);
post.setHeader("Accept", "application/json");
post.setHeader("Content-Type", "application/json;charset=UTF-8");
if (headers.size() > 0) {
for (Map.Entry<String, Object> header : headers.entrySet()) {
post.setHeader(header.getKey(), String.valueOf(header.getValue()));
}
}
//超时时间
RequestConfig requestConfig = RequestConfig.custom()
.setConnectTimeout(15000).setConnectionRequestTimeout(15000)
.setSocketTimeout(15000).build();
post.setConfig(requestConfig);
if (data != null) {
post.setEntity((new StringEntity(data, "UTF-8")));
}
response = httpClient.execute(post);
stringBuffer = getResult(response.getEntity());
} catch (Exception e) {
logger.error("", e);
} finally {
if (null != httpClient)
httpClient.close();
if (null != response)
response.close();
}
return stringBuffer;
}
private static StringBuilder getResult(HttpEntity entity) throws IOException {
StringBuilder stringBuffer = null;
if (null != entity) {
BufferedReader br = new BufferedReader(new InputStreamReader(entity.getContent()));
stringBuffer = new StringBuilder();
String str = "";
while ((str = br.readLine()) != null)
stringBuffer.append(str);
}
return stringBuffer;
}
}
